Kindred Group Reports Steady Financial Growth Amid Regulatory Challenges

In the competitive world of online gaming and sports betting, Kindred Group has emerged with a positive financial report for the fourth quarter. The company announced a modest 2% increase in Q4 revenues, which rose to £313 million. This uptick contributed to an impressive annual gross-win revenue tally of £1.17 billion.

More striking is the growth in underlying EBITDA (Earnings Before Interest, Taxes, Depreciation, and Amortization) for the year 2023, reaching £205 million. The fourth quarter alone saw EBITDA soar by 45%, amounting to £57 million. As of year-end, Kindred's cash and cash equivalents stood at a healthy £240 million, indicating solid liquidity and financial resilience.

Diverse Performance Across Sports Betting and Casino Segments

The sports betting margin after free bets remained low at 9.9%, with sports betting gross win revenue totaling £115 million. Meanwhile, the casino and games segments witnessed a healthier performance, enjoying a 5% growth. US Market Withdrawal and Its Financial Impact

A strategic retreat from certain US states had a noticeable impact on Kindred's finances, specifically a £6 million hit to EBITDA. While this withdrawal represents a setback, it also reflects the company's agility in navigating complex and fluctuating international markets.

Groupe FDJ's Takeover Proposal: A New European Gaming Giant?

In a significant development, Groupe FDJ has extended an offer to acquire Kindred Group at €11.40 per share. This proposal values Kindred at approximately €2.6 billion and represents a 24% premium over the company's current enterprise value. The Kindred board has expressed favor towards the takeover, and key investors have echoed this sentiment. Shareholders representing around 27.9% of Kindred shares have already committed to accepting the offer.

The tender offer is scheduled to commence on February 19, 2024, marking the potential beginning of a merger that could create Europe’s second-largest gaming operator.
